OSPO Roadmap Changelog

Everything that changes in the roadmap is recorded here, in the open, for everyone. Members and anonymous visitors see the same history. Most recent changes appear first.

Two things never change once a node ships: its identity and your saved progress. When a node is renamed or moved, your tracked status stays intact. Only a genuine content change, a node added, retired, or materially revised, is a substantive entry below.

2026-09-14: Launch

The roadmap goes live: a Foundation entry plus four jobs (Governance & Standards, Legal & Compliance, Technical Oversight & Security, Community & Ecosystem) across three maturity stages (Getting Started, Formalization, Scaling). The full public map is available from day one so the whole structure is open to feedback. In-depth member guidance begins with the Foundation steps and expands from there.
